Find And Replace version 7.00b        (REPLACE7.MDA)

Summary:

  An add-in library for Microsoft Access 7.0 (Access 95).

  This program provides a "Find and Replace" function for Tables (searching
  design elements such as field names, not the data in the table), Queries,
  Forms, Reports, Macros, and Modules (MSAccess 7.0 only provides Find and
  Replace for Modules).  Find And Replace can be used to change names of
  objects through the entire database (as compared to MS Access itself which
  provides minimal built-in name change propagation).  In addition to
  facilitating name changes it has other uses, such as: a) changing the path
  in the connect string for attached tables (search for old path, replace
  with new; attachment gets refreshed) and b) searching for occurences of a
  given function to enable you to change the parameters.  Additional features
  are available for registered users (e.g. cross-reference report).
  The intended user of this module is a programmer.

Recent Version History:

ver 7.00b 10/23/96
  Reduced the number of key sequences that must not be redefined (for Find and 
  Replace to work) to one (alt-E for the english version).  Fixed a bug causing
  module searches to fail when, before you start Find and Replace, you minimize
  Access then you click the control box of the icon (unlikely if you are using
  Win95 or NT4), then restore or maximize the Access window, and then start Find
  and Replace (don't ask... it's a Windows API thing).

ver 7.00a 10/18/96
  Fixed bug in module changes when replacing a string with nothing (i.e. 
  deleting a string).  Fixed custom color setting for highlighted text in the 
  replace dialog.  Support for code changes in German version of Access removed 
  pending bug resolution.

ver 7.00  10/10/96
  Initial Release for Access 7
